Assertion (A): The development of attachment in infants is crucial for their emotional security and later social interactions.
Reason (R): Responsive and sensitive parenting fosters trust, which is essential for a child's exploration of the world.
  • a)
    If both Assertion and Reason are true and Reason is the correct explanation of Assertion
  • b)
    If both Assertion and Reason are true but Reason is not the correct explanation of Assertion
  • c)
    If Assertion is true but Reason is false
  • d)
    If both Assertion and Reason are false
Correct answer is option 'A'. Can you explain this answer?
Most Upvoted Answer
Assertion (A): The development of attachment in infants is crucial for...
  • The Assertion is correct; research highlights the significance of attachment in infants for their emotional and social development.
  • The Reason is also correct; it aligns with theories suggesting that responsive parenting builds trust.
  • The Reason provides an accurate explanation for the Assertion, as trust enables exploration, which is fundamental for emotional security.
